1.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
What type of reaction involves two separate molecules forming a cyclic compound by generating two new sigma bonds?
[4 + 2] Cycloaddition
[3,3] Sigmatropic shift
6-electron electrocyclization
Nazarov cyclization
2.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
In a 6-electron electrocyclization, what happens to the pi and sigma bonds?
One pi bond is formed, and two sigma bonds are lost.
Two pi bonds are formed, and one sigma bond is lost.
One sigma bond is formed, and one pi bond is lost.
Two sigma bonds are formed, and one pi bond is lost.
3.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
What is the stereochemical requirement for a [4 + 2] electrocyclization involving an E, Z, E triene?
Conrotatory rotation of termini
Disrotatory rotation of termini
No rotation required
Random rotation of termini
4.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
Why are 4-electron cyclizations less common?
They produce unstable products.
They are too slow to be practical.
They have an anti-aromatic transition state.
They require high temperatures.
5.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
In a 4-electron cyclization, how do the termini of the diene rotate to form a new sigma bond?
Randomly
No rotation is needed
In the same direction
In opposite directions
6.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
What is the result of reacting a cyclobutene with maleic anhydride?
A single sigma bond
An aromatic compound
A complex polycyclic structure
A simple diene
7.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
What is the key feature of the cascade reaction involving tetraenes and maleic anhydride?
It forms a single product.
It involves a single reaction step.
It creates multiple chiral centers.
It is not stereoselective.
